You definitely want to get into cryptos. And mining as an entry point is certainly 1 way.

The other ways are:

1.to buy bitcoin / altcoins directly from sellers or exchanges
2.selling somthing of value/ providing a service in exchange for crypto as payment
3.earning bounties / airdrops from this forum

Each of the methods holds a different appeal. And for sure, u need to choose one that fits u.

..Mining is basically a part time job that u undertake with urself as ur boss. U will incur initial startup costs (cost of mining hardware) and then u have to pay a recurring variable cost (cost of ur electricity). I suggest u also pay urself a small allowance for 'minding the shop'.

..Buying cryptos is basically a 'speculative investment' type approach. When price moves, by somthing like +/- 5% per day, ur investment grows or shrinks accordingly.

..Selling somthing of value for cryptos is a longshot if u ur plan is to sell ur used gear. As for working for crypto, i don't know of specific marketplace for this but i'm sure u can also arrange some kind of ex-deal, such as....

..Bonuses and airdrops from this forum, which have the smallest barrier to entry.

If I may suggest, do this:
..instead of working directly for crypto payments, work some other jobs and use ur income to buy some cryptos
..in ur spare time, work on the airdrops and bounties on this forum
..mining is not really a fire & forget type of venture because u have to make sure ur rig is operational 24x7 which means u need to handle any hardware, software, or connection problems soonest (minimal downtime)
